GONYK wrote:It's the fact that it didn't have to come to this. Melo could have prevented this kind of deal if he chose to do so. He'd have his money, his city, and a stronger team. Instead, he went pu$$y and now we are paying for it.


It is amazing that we arguably have a top 7 NBA player gift-wrap himself to a team & city that needs another impact player. And yet many people here are bent over the fact that he didn't do enough to become a Knick.

Sorry but Carmelo put himself way, way out there for the Knicks. He basically burned his boats in Denver and all but made himself untradeable to anyone but NY. Lebron didn't do that. Amare didn't do it. Wade didn't do it and neither did Kobe, Shaq or any other superstar in the past 25 odd years. Guys on the level of Carmelo are rare and if you have one present themselves to you on your doorstep you'd be wise to take them in.

Like most I would have loved to have had him for nothing but once the Nets came back in NY had to pony up.

Frank Isola from Daily News was on SNY Live and reported the Nuggets do not want Wilson Chandler because he becomes a restricted free agent after the season. They want Fields instead. They want Gallo, Fields, Curry, 1st round pick and Felton.

He also said Dolan has taken over the discussions on a possible trade instead of Walsh and D'antoni.

Walsh and D'Antoni think it's a bit too much.

Isiah is basically our GM through Dolan now.
